Hello Jo, I think these photos have some great colour and contrast. subjects that are normally on sponges like these tend to camouflage in more when shot head on even though that’s normally the better technique when shooting macro. I think your decision in going back and getting that side on shot is in my eyes better for the fact the subject is more recognisable with the side on profile. As the eyes aren’t completely obvious in the front on shot then the viewer cant connect with the subject as much. So getting a diversity of shot sizes and angles of the same subject is always a good thing and especially reviewing images underwater might make you want to reshoot like you did in this case!!
